Your users folder, and the following '/Library/' folders - 'Application Support', 'PreferencePanes', 'Printers', 'Screen Savers', and 'Startup Items'.

The reasons for copying the menitoned '/Library/' folders.
You may have added 'PreferencePanes' ('System Preferences' utilities) and 'Screen Savers' for all users to use.
Some third party applications install files in the Application Support' and 'Startup Items' folders.
The 'Tiger' installation does not install all the printer drivers that 'Panther' does. For example, 'Tiger' does not install the 'C42Series.plugin' driver; but, the one from 'Panther' works with 'Tiger', as expected.

last report:
i asked a friend for his powerbook...
1- i connected mine to his with a firewire cable (pressing the T key while booting mine)...
2- i installed tiger from his notebook to my HD...
3- after the succesfull installation, his comp restarted and booted from my HD...
4- i quit the "user account registration" (or something like that), and shut down his computer
5- i opened the "restart utility?" (sorry, dont remember the name) booting from tiger cd (on his PoweBook)... and selected to boot from his HD (not mine this time...)
6- i ejected my HD from his computer
7- shut down mine
8- i booted from my computer, complete the registration problem, and everything is working pretty well so far :) :)
